We're starting the release process for FreeBSD 7.2-RELEASE.  The major
highlights of the schedule are:

        Code Freeze:            March 23rd
        BETA1                   March 30th
        Branch                  April 10th
        RC1                     April 13th
        RC2                     April 20th
        Release:                May 4th

The full schedule is here:

  http://www.freebsd.org/releases/7.2R/schedule.html

though most of "the other events" haven't been given specific dates yet.

Since it's often the case that developers process quite a few
outstanding MFCs during the last couple days before a code freeze starts
I have changed RELENG_7 to say it is 7.2-PRERELEASE now as a bit of a
heads-up that the release cycle is imminent.  You might need to be a
tiny bit more careful using RELENG_7 right now because the odds of you
getting a snapshot of the tree taken part way through someone doing
something that required multiple commits goes up during this phase of a
release.
